    This cute little restaurant ( take out only?) is in the Japan market place. I walked in- the staff was very sweet, and helpful. She helped me choosing the sushi rolls to order. I got two rolls for our dinner. Both the sushi rolls were fresh, tasty and with top ingredients. They took almost 25 minutes to get the stuff ready. I was waiting outside and once done she called me and I picked up. Super easy! I don’t mind waiting even longer if the food is freshly made, with all things fresh inside. Highly recommended!

  • Llyallowyn  5

    The same delicious sushi served in Akai Hana and Tensuke Market is available to order. It's some of the best in town and the only place I can order sour plum rolls. There's no seating inside, but sometimes when the weather is nice you can sit outside, or in the Express dining room.
